Learn That Word

Synonyms for Effusive (same or very similar meaning)

WordNet sense 1 (uttered with unrestrained enthusiasm):
gushing, burbling, burbly

WordNet sense 2 (full of life and energy):

WordNet sense 3 (extravagantly demonstrative):
emotional, gushy

WordNet sense 4 (given to or marked by the open expression of emotion):

From the ODE community, based on WordNetadd/edit